The Quarryman Inn — Restaurant in England

Name
The Quarryman Inn
Description
Wood-panelled pub serving real ale and refined Cornwall-sourced dishes, plus a courtyard with pond.

We came in as a party of 8 having eaten here before. Friendly efficient service. The place is clean and well cared for inside and out and is dog friendly. Having ordered 2 steaks- one sirloin, the other a rib eye, my Dad’s ribeye was very gristly and he barely ate any of it leaving the cut up remnants on his plate. The waiting staff took it away having asked how the meal was and having been informed that the steak was tough said absolutely nothing and offered no apology despite the amount of “meat” left behind. I would have thought that a refund of this meal or some gesture of goodwill might have been offered as my Dad barely ate a mouthful of the £25 steak. When we enquired about this meal being knocked off the bill the waiter said “what you need to realise is that ribeye IS fatty” Please don’t patronise us, we know the difference between gristle and fat. Had we known they would not offer is a reduced bill, we wouldn’t have stayed longer and ordered dessert.. All restaurants can have issues with some of the food they serve but this problem could have been resolved professionally and fairly and the resulting review here would have been glowing. Poor customer service costs restaurants repeat business - not to mention the all Important loss of word of mouth recommendations. Such a shame as all other meals were lovely and no complaints, but we won’t be back on the basis that we left...

Disappointing visit with family. Initially very accommodating, relocating us to enable us to have a table our dog could join us at. Sadly went downhill from there. Ordered 2 T-Bone steaks rare. They came medium at best, more like Med- well done. No blood at all and a tiny bit of pink. Picture below. We sent them back as they weren’t cheap only to be rudely told we were wrong and the chef said they are rare. They had none left so what did we want. The attitude left us pretty annoyed. We sent one back and ate the other. The other meals were OK. Sea Bass was on the small size for the price. Roast was an excellent size with loads of food for the price but tough over cooked beef. Lovely cauliflower cheese. Kids meals were all good but expensive. £7-8 with no drink or pudding included. Almost as much as an adult.

At the end, the owner came to discuss the issues. There was never an attempt at an apology or an admission they were wrong. Only an admission it was the end of a busy weekend. Overall a disappointing meal. Came to £96 for 2 adults and 5 kids as they didn’t charge for the steaks. One drink each and no starters or desserts so on the...

Me and my partner make trips to Cornwall for this pub. We have visited x3 and have not been disappointed. We always order the steak and a side of peppercorn sauce. The peppercorn sauce is beautiful- thick and full of flavour, me and my partner share one so we are not over powering the taste of the steak itself. It is absolutely the best steak I have tasted worldwide. There is always a variety of local beers served on tap, it’s the only time my partner allows me to drive his car (so he can enjoy a few beers) and the staff are always friendly. I would recommend booking early during peak tourist season to avoid disappointment as it’s always been popular when we have visited. The only downside is, they changed the chopped peas on this dish- we used to love those. We can’t make comment on any other dish but they look tasty when we have observed other diners. Nonetheless we still love this place.

IF ONLY all pub / restaurants had such excellent cheerful service and such great food on offer. I recommend "ham egg and chips" and "line caught hake chips and peas, with tartar sauce and a pot of tea" Simply Great value at £19 for a really excellent meal The woman who served us was just an abject lesson in what really attentive service can be. We Can't recommend it highly enough. If your in wadebridge drive up past Tesco superstore on your left, to the roundabout ( with all the push bikes on it) turn left onto the A39, then an almost immediate right hand turn, Then about a mile up the lane on your right. you'll see "The Quarryman". Really lovely food and service and ample free parking , (not some tiny lined out parking bays) I've been holidaying in Wadebridge and Polzeath for 25 years, and have only just discovered this GEM of a place. HIGHLY RECOMMENDED.
